8, Cherrywood Close, Newton Abbot is recorded publicly as a mid-century freehold house across 1,519 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 635 m2 plot.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 8, Cherrywood Close, Newton Abbot is £381,223 and its rental estimate is £1,424 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.

The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 8, Cherrywood Close, Newton Abbot, we estimate a market value of £400,284 and a rental value of £1,495 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£354,538 and £1,324 per month respectively.
Over the last year, 8, Cherrywood Close, Newton Abbot has seen its estimated sale value move down by £9,657 (2.5%) and its estimated rental value increase by £42 per month (2.9%). This results in an estimated gross rental yield of 4.5%.
HM Land Registry records the plot of land for 8, Cherrywood Close, Newton Abbot as measuring 635 m2.
That makes it the largest plot in the postcode, where all 11 other houses have recorded plot data.
8, Cherrywood Close, Newton Abbot has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 23 May 2009.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
The most recent sale of 8, Cherrywood Close, Newton Abbot completed on 31st March 2015 at £252,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 the property has sold twice.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 31.7% over the period since March 2015.
